<p><i>Empowered Learning Through International Virtual Exchange</i> is a rich and diverse collection of case studies, theoretical explorations, research projects, and best practices on international virtual exchange.</p><p>International Virtue Exchange (IVE) offers a powerful alternative to traditional forms of international exchange by leveraging technology to connect individuals and institutions across the globe, providing more accessible and sustainable opportunities for cross-cultural engagement. Using authentic examples from higher education, this edited volume delves into the transformative and concrete impacts of virtual exchange in fostering global connections, removing barriers, and building bridges across cultures and nations. By highlighting successful models, identifying common challenges, and depicting real-world collaborations, these chapters aim to advance the field of IVE and inspire global institutions to adopt and support such initiatives in their own contexts.</p><p>Researchers, educators, designers and technologists, and policymakers will find a wealth of replicable experiences from Australia, Brazil, the Dominican Republic, Germany, China, Ireland, Japan, Tunisia, the United States, and elsewhere.</p>
